<p>Here are some of the bill's key provisions:</p>
<ul>
    <li>Starting in 2010 charging consumers who pay by phone would be banned. </li>
    <li>Sudden surges in interest rates would also be banned. </li>
    <li>For consumers, it would clarify the cost of big ticket items by forcing consumers to recognize how much they are paying in interest. </li>
    <li>Card companies would also have to provide information on consumer counseling and debt management.</li>
